Output c58ee6a6aec260fee11cfabd3343fe1aed0bbc13093d00fef1d9ba91b1b686a6:51

value
649158647
script pubkey
OP_0 OP_PUSHBYTES_20 e36465257c20d6d6ace5f4f5e41a751d0d75d69e
address
bc1qudjx2ftuyrtddt897n67gxn4r5xht4578h33mx
transaction
c58ee6a6aec260fee11cfabd3343fe1aed0bbc13093d00fef1d9ba91b1b686a6
spent
true